HIF Global Awarded First US Approval for e-Fuels Design Pathway

HOUSTON, TEXAS (Editors at Energy Analytics Institute, 11.Mar.2025) — HIF Global has been awarded the first US approval for an e-Fuels pathway. 

The Tier II Design Pathway Certification, granted under the California Air Resource Board’s (CARB) Low Carbon Fuel Standard (LCFS) Program, strengthens the market for e-Fuels production, HIF Global announced on 11 Mar. 2025 in an official statement.

“e-Fuels are synthetic hydrocarbons that seamlessly integrate with today’s existing infrastructure and engines,“ HIF Global Board executive director Meg Gentle said in the statement.

“This LCFS certification underscores the growing demand for e-Fuels in the U.S. and globally, which could reach more than 250 mtpa by 2035, providing opportunity for over $1 trillion in potential capital investment in new facilities to produce the fuels, including HIF Global’s 1.4 mtpa e-Fuels project in Matagorda County, Texas,” Gentle said. 

HIF Global‘s Tier II Design Pathway Certification includes e-SAF, e-Naphtha, and e-Diesel as opt-in fuels allowing producers to apply and generate credits for their e-Fuels under the program.
